.Still Waiting to Exhale

For the week of August 11-17, 2010.

The world may not have come to an end on July 26 with a single cinematic event reminiscent of a scene directed by Michael Bay, but there were enough micro-Armageddons to tilt plenty of personal worlds at a new angle to the Sun. And this week, as dynamic planetary patterns continue to generate an unsettled atmosphere, reactions to those personal pole shifts are likely to play out as a need to act out. Expect outbursts that at first glance seem disproportionate to the immediate or obvious cause, but upon deeper inspection reveal anxiety about how to handle the current emotional disruption. While the worst of the astral weather is starting to recede (it won’t be over completely until mid-September), we are still in the wake of gigantic waves of change — and that translates to continued uncertainty about the future. So if and when you encounter extreme emotional reactions, yours or others’, try to remember to breathe before you blurt. Beyond the pleasure of blowing off steam, there’s no need to contribute to the agitation. We co-create the future with our every thought, word, and deed, and although we can’t necessarily control what is already set in motion, we can make every effort to neutralize negativity by staying positive and enthusiastic about the potential for conscious transformation.

Several factors contribute to this week’s disconcerting air. First, Uranus retrogrades back into Pisces on August 13, where it will stay until March 11, 2011. Its return to Pisces will dial down the heat of the moment just a tad — say, from eleven to ten. But the planet of revolution continues to stay in close proximity to Jupiter, who also returns to Pisces on September 9, which means that startling plot twists will continue to confound even the best prepared. Be aware: As Uranus and Jupiter retrograde and revisit the events of the last several months, so will we. Don’t be surprised if you have a change of heart, but also understand that when Uranus moves back into Aries, you just might change your heart and mind, again.

Next, we are still in the throes of the final Saturn/Pluto square, which is exact on August 21. This signature symbolizes self-destruction, and the poisonous venom of harsh judgment that denies the humanity of another. At the risk of repeating myself, avoid pointing a blaming finger. Instead, recognize that most of what we judge so severely in others is what we despise most in ourselves.

We are also in the approach to the next Mercury Retrograde phase, which begins on August 20 and ends on September 12. Mercury Retrograde is always about review and reflection, and because we have so much to think about, this retrograde ought to be quite revelatory. Be aware that the three days before and after a retrograde pose just as much of a problem as the retrograde itself, so back up all of your data now.

As the week unfolds, do your best to manage the stress by focusing on what brings you joy. While that may involve overcoming enormous obstacles, a joyous heart is a resilient heart.
